Conrad Vogt
Summary
Conrad Vogt is a human[1]. Born in Nienburg/Weser[2], he… he was born on September 15, 1634[3]. He died in Königsberg[4]. He died on May 15, 1691[5]. He worked as a poet[6], university teacher[7], and writer[8].
